- name : "Adobe Premiere Clip - Android and Web Application"
description : "<ul>
<li>
Adobe Premiere Clip is a video editing application with 100k+ installs.
</li>
<li>
Created MOV file playback support on Android which does not natively support it. For this I built
an efficient video/audio sample loader that interacts with decoders in other threads to give a seamless
video/audio playback. Built an efficient Thumbnail extractor that can fetch frames for Ultra HD videos.
</li>
<li>
Designed and built backend and UX for a video player and an editor that can edit a sequence of
videos and images. Built features such as trimming, transition between clips, sequence editing,
lighting filters such as exposure, highlights, shadows, audio controls etc.
</li>
<li>
Designed internal data models for Projects and Sequence of media files.
Created framework for interaction between UI, playback and rendering threads on Android.
</li>
<li>
Built an efficient Rendering pipeline that applies filters to frames on the fly during video playback.
Built a single shader in OpenGL that implements several filters by loading LUT (Lookup Table) data in
an intelligent way.
</li></ul>
